6.0-magnitude quake rocks DavOr; Phivolcs expects aftershocks

MANILA — A 6.0 magnitude earthquake rocked Davao Oriental before noon Thursday, the Philippine Institute of Volcanology and Seismology (Phivolcs) reported.

The quake of tectonic origin that jolted Tarragona town had a depth of 27 kilometers, Phivolcs added.

Intensity 4 was recorded in Tarragona, Mati City, Lupon and Manay in Davao Oriental; and Tagum City in Davao del Norte.

Intensity 3 was felt in Davao City, Cagayan de Oro City, and General Santos City.

Intensity 2 was reported in Bislig City; Surigao City; Alabel and Malapatan, Sarangani; and Hinatuan, Surigao del Sur.

Phivolcs added that Intensity 2 was felt in Bislig City and Kidapawan City.

The state agency said it expects aftershocks, but no damage from the Davao quake has been reported as of this writing. (Ma. Cristina Arayata/PNA)
